If your 2013 Volvo XC60 has a persistent service light, it indicates that the vehicle's onboard diagnostics system has detected an issue that requires attention. This could relate to routine maintenance, emissions control, or other mechanical problems.
A persistent service light on your 2013 Volvo XC60 can indicate a variety of issues. By following these diagnostic steps and repairs, you can effectively address the problem.
